Exciting opportunity for sixth formers
An off-shore law firm with offices on the Isle of Man is offering sixth formers a unique work experience opportunity next summer.
Appleby opens the doors to its 'Appleby Academy' once a year, where the successful candidate is given an extensive insight into the global organisation.
Launched in 2012, the programme runs in conjunction with Junior Achievement.
Interested year 13 students must apply, and then investigate a business challenge created by the firm - the top three of those will present to a panel of judges to try and win the paid placement.
The deadline for registration is Friday 5 October.
